대학생의 기업가적 태도가 창업잠재성에 미치는 영향에 관한 연구
A Study on the Influence of Entrepreneurial Attitude of University Students on Entrepreneurial Potential 원문보기

벤처창업연구= Asia-Pacific journal of business and venturing, v.16 no.2, 2021년, pp.123 - 141  

손종서 (숙명여자대학교 창업보육센터) ,  김진수 (중앙대학교 경영학부)

초록

본 연구는 대학생의 창업에 있어 기업가적 태도가 창업기회 인식과 대학생의 창업잠재성에 미치는 영향 관계를 확인하였다. 이에 대학생의 창업잠재성 제고에 영향을 미치는 기업가적 태도 및 창업기회 인식 형성에 유의미한 영향 관계를 확인하고 창업교육과 역할모델에 따른 변수 간 영향 관계를 분석하였다. 연구결과를 요약하면 첫째, 창의성, 리더십, 개인통제는 정보탐색에 유의한 영향을 미치는 것으로 나타났으며, 통찰력과 성취감은 통계적으로 정보탐색에 유의한 영향을 미치지 않는 것으로 나타났다. 둘째, 창의성, 리더십, 통찰력이 정보결합에 유의한 영향을 미치는 것으로 나타났으며, 성취감과 개인통제는 통계적으로 정보결합에 유의한 영향을 미치지 않는 것으로 나타났다. 셋째, 창의성, 리더십, 개인통제는 기회포착에 유의한 영향을 미치는 것으로 나타났으며 통찰력과 성취감은 기회포착에 통계적으로 유의한 영향을 미치지 않는 것으로 나타났다. 넷째, 정보탐색, 기회포착은 인지된 창업가망성에 유의한 영향을 미치는 것으로 나타났으며 정보결합은 통계적으로 인지된 창업가망성에 유의한 영향을 미치지 않는 것으로 나타났다. 다섯째, 정보탐색, 기회포착은 인지된 창업타당성에 유의한 영향을 미치는 것으로 나타났으며 정보결합은 통계적으로 인지된 창업타당성에 유의한 영향을 미치지 않는 것으로 나타났다. 마지막으로 기업가적 태도와 창업기회 인식 간의 관계에서 창업교육프로그램은 유의미한 조절적 역할을 하는 것으로 나타났으며, 창업기회 인식과 창업잠재성 간의 관계에서 역할 모델은 유의미한 역할을 하는 것으로 나타났다. 본 연구는 대학 및 정부 차원에서 지원하고 있는 창업교육 활동의 대상인 대학생의 창업교육과 역할모델 효과에 대해 살펴보고, 창업에 대한 지각된 열망과 지각된 실행가능성이 형성되어야만 창업의도로 이어지기 때문에 바로 창업을 하지 않은 대학생의 창업잠재성관련 시사점을 제언하였다.
